  • yougetbanned#1188 yougetbanned Member Posts: 9 Arc User
    honestly utter waste of dev ressources.
    cutscenes which were skippable need now a 2sec pressdown of ESC.
    cutscenes which weren't skippable are still NOT skippable (formal signing in Time&Tide, initial rant on New romulus, initial briefing on voth, initial briefing on voth groundbattlezones etc.)
    this "feature" also apparently makes the mission maps loads slower almost stuck a while at 2 percent, then jumping to 35 something and then up to 100.
  • borg0vermindborg0vermind Member Posts: 498 Arc User
    edited August 2021
    This is a protection against breaking content.
    For certain single player missions, if you ESC too fast, the mission will not progress. Example: there's a blast door on the Disco story (the one you get to meet Red Angel when entering) that certainly will not open if you instant-ESC the cutscene. You can't do anything but start from the beginning.
